The biliary atresia splenic malformation syndrome: a 28-year single-center retrospective study.
The Journal of pediatrics - 1 Sept 2006
Davenport Mark, Tizzard Sarah A, Underhill James, Mieli-Vergani Giorgina, Portmann Bernard, Hadzić Nedim
Abstract excerpt
We carried out a retrospective review of infants with biliary atresia splenic malformation (BASM). We found that 56 infants (10.2%) met the criteria for inclusion from a series of 548 infants (from January 1977 to December 2004). Syndromic infants were more likely to be female (P = .04) and to have a higher incidence of antenatal pathology (specifically maternal diabetes; 12.5% vs 1.2%; P < .0001). Situs inversus...
